 Making friends in college in India, like anywhere else, is a natural part of the college experience. Here are some tips to help you make friends and build a social network:


Attend Orientation Programs: Take advantage of orientation programs organized by the college. These events provide an excellent opportunity to meet new people, including fellow students and seniors.


Join Clubs and Societies: Most colleges in India have a variety of clubs and societies covering different interests. Joining these groups allows you to meet people who share similar interests and passions.


Participate in Extracurricular Activities: Whether it's sports, cultural events, or volunteer activities, participating in extracurricular activities is a great way to meet people outside the classroom.


Be Open and Approachable: Smile, make eye contact, and be open to conversations. Don't be afraid to initiate a chat with your classmates, roommates, or people you meet in common areas.


Attend Social Events: Colleges often organize social events, parties, and festivals. Attend these gatherings to socialize and meet new people in a more relaxed setting.


Study Groups: Joining or forming study groups is an excellent way to connect with classmates. It not only helps academically but also provides a chance to build friendships.


Explore Common Areas: Spend time in common areas such as the cafeteria, library, or recreational spaces. These areas are often hubs for social interaction.


Be a Good Listener: Show genuine interest in others. Being a good listener is a valuable skill and can help you connect with people on a deeper level.


Participate in College Events: Attend college fests, cultural events, and celebrations. These events are not only enjoyable but also offer opportunities to meet a diverse group of people.


Be Yourself: Authenticity is key. Be true to yourself, and you'll naturally attract friends who appreciate you for who you are.


Utilize Social Media: Many colleges have official social media groups or pages where students can connect. Join these groups to stay updated on college events and connect with your peers.


Attend Workshops and Seminars: Participate in workshops, seminars, and guest lectures. These events not only enhance your knowledge but also provide chances to interact with like-minded individuals.
